Storm damage repair services involve assessing and restoring properties that have been affected by severe weather events such as hurricanes, heavy winds, hail, or rain. These services typically include the removal of debris, repair or replacement of damaged roofing, siding, windows, and fascia, as well as addressing structural issues caused by the storm. The goal is to restore the property’s integrity and appearance while preventing further damage from exposure to the elements. Professionals in this field work to ensure that properties are stabilized and protected against future weather-related risks.

These services help resolve a range of problems resulting from storm impacts. Common issues include roof leaks, broken or missing shingles, damaged gutters, and compromised exterior walls. Storm damage can also lead to interior problems such as water intrusion, mold growth, and compromised insulation. Repairing these damages promptly can help prevent more costly repairs down the line and reduce the risk of safety hazards. Storm damage repair specialists focus on restoring the property’s functionality and safety, often working with property owners to address both visible and hidden damages.

Various types of properties utilize storm damage repair services, including residential homes, multi-family complexes, commercial buildings, and industrial facilities. Residential properties are often the most affected, especially those with older or less durable roofing and exterior materials. Commercial properties, such as retail stores, offices, and warehouses, may also require repairs to minimize business disruptions and ensure safety. The overview below groups typical Storm Damage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Okaloosa County, FL.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Roof Repair Costs - Repairing storm-damaged roofs typically ranges from $1,000 to $5,000, depending on the extent of damage. For example, replacing missing shingles may cost around $300 to $800, while extensive repairs could reach higher amounts.

Siding Repair Expenses - Repair costs for storm-damaged siding usually fall between $500 and $3,000. Minor fixes, like replacing a few panels, may be around $200 to $600, whereas more significant damage can increase costs significantly.

Window and Door Repairs - Fixing or replacing storm-damaged windows and doors generally costs from $300 to $2,500. The price varies based on the size and type of the window or door needing repair or replacement.

Structural Damage Repair - Addressing structural damage from storms can range from $2,000 to over $10,000. Costs depend on the severity of damage to frameworks, beams, and foundational elements, with larger projects costing more.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
